37.3% of the people in Riverside are religious:
- 6.6% are Baptist
- 0.7% are Episcopalian
- 13.1% are Catholic
- 2.5% are Lutheran
- 5.4% are Methodist
- 0.5% are Pentecostal
- 0.6% are Presbyterian
- 2.3% are Church of Jesus Christ
- 5.6% are another Christian faith
- 0.0% are Judaism
- 0.0% are an eastern faith
- 0.0% affilitates with Islam
